Meanwhile, we are hearing very little about a case of unacceptable censorship taking place in Mississippi – right now.

In the city of Clarksdale, the local newspaper, the Press Register, has been ordered by a judge to take down an editorial that ran on February 18. As bad as this already sounds, the offensiveness spikes when you see the filing was sought and obtained by the local government.
